SYRUPUS SUCCI LIMONIS.
Syrup of Limon-Juice.
Take of Limon-juice, ftrained, after thefoeces have fubfided, two pints.
Double-refined Sugar, by weight,fifty ounces.
Diffolve the fugar that it may be made a Sy-rup.
Make, in the fame manner, a Syrup of theJuice of Mulberry,
Raspberry, andBlack Currant.
R E M A R K.
In the preparauon of thefe Syrups from fruits,the veffel employed fliould be of glafs, or what iscalled ftone-ware. Earchen veffels, glafed widi lead,are certainly to be avoided.
